Hey, welcome! Great to see you jumping into commercial and multifamily investing—there’s a ton of opportunity there once you get the basics down. I’m on a similar path here in the Chicago area, and getting that foundational knowledge early has made a huge difference.

If you're just getting started, I'd recommend:

  • Learning how to analyze deals (NOI, cap rate, DSCR, etc.)

  • Getting familiar with financing options for 5+ unit properties (since they fall under commercial lending)

  • Connecting with brokers who specialize in multifamily or mixed-use properties in your target markets
